What is Encompass Corporation?
Founded in Sydney in 2011 by seasoned technology professionals Wayne Johnson and Roger Carson, Encompass Corporation specializes in visual analytics and automation for commercial data users. The company's core philosophy, as articulated by Roger Carson, is that "it's not about the data, it's about what you do with data." This focus positions Encompass Corporation as a key player in transforming raw commercial information into actionable insights through advanced visual tools and automated processes. How much funding has Encompass Corporation raised?
Encompass Corporation has raised a total of $35.3M across 2 funding rounds:

Private Equity (2016): $2.3M, investors not publicly disclosed
Unspecified (2022): $33M led by Serendipity Capital, Microequities Venture Capital, Perennial Partners, and Seven Seat Capital
